After replacing windows in Medfield homes, you'll notice the most immediate difference in eliminated cold spots near window walls and the absence of frost patterns on interior glass during winter mornings. Rooms maintain even temperatures from floor to ceiling, and furnace run time decreases because heated air no longer escapes through compromised seals and deteriorated weatherstripping. The condensation that previously formed between double-pane glass layers—indicating seal failure and inert gas loss—disappears entirely with new units that maintain their thermal barriers.

The Replacement Process From Evaluation Through Final Inspection
Evaluation begins with checking operating sashes for smooth movement, inspecting glazing for seal failure evidenced by condensation or haze between panes, and examining frames for rot where water has penetrated. Measuring captures the actual rough opening dimensions rather than relying on standard sizes, because settling and previous repairs often leave openings out of square by half an inch or more. Removing old windows requires cutting through interior stops and exterior casing while preserving surrounding materials, then extracting the frame assembly and inspecting the rough opening for water damage or missing flashing.
New window installation includes shimming the frame level and plumb, securing it with appropriate fasteners for the wall construction type, and applying low-expansion foam insulation that fills voids without bowing the frame. Exterior flashing integrates with existing water-resistive barriers, and interior trim reinstallation seals the final air leakage path. Final inspection verifies that sashes operate smoothly, locks engage fully, and no light gaps exist around the closed sash perimeter when backlit. What Professional Replacement Includes Beyond the Window Unit
Complete replacement addresses every component affecting performance, not just swapping the visible window unit into an existing rough opening.
- Rough opening inspection and repair of rot, water damage, or structural deficiencies before new window installation
- Precise measurement accounting for out-of-square conditions and settlement in Medfield's mix of colonial and ranch-style homes
- Proper flashing installation that ties into existing water management layers and prevents future moisture intrusion
- Insulation application that fills gaps without creating frame distortion or compression that breaks seals over time
- Final inspection including operational testing, lock engagement verification, and light-gap checks around the full sash perimeter
This comprehensive approach prevents the common failures that occur when replacement focuses only on the window unit while ignoring the surrounding assembly.
